Answer:

Method 1:

Find the Least Common Denominator (LCD) of all the denominators in the complex fractions.

Multiply this LCD to the numerator and denominator of the complex fraction.

Simplify, if necessary.

Method 2:

Create a single fraction in the numerator and denominator.

Apply the division rule of fractions by multiplying the numerator by the reciprocal or inverse of the denominator.

Simplify, if necessary.
